I called SGX yesterday. The CSO said can walk in without appt to apply. If come on Sat morning, expect to wait 30 mins to 1 hour. Also do not go during weekdays lunchtime.

If not in a hurry, she advises to mail in application. I asked if bank e-statements count, she said no. (Thought the website said it's ok)
